Port City Brewing Company and Lost Dog Café have partnered to support Lost Dog and Cat Rescue Foundation by brewing a limited-edition IPA for National Adopt-a-Dog Month in October.

On Saturday, October 14th, Lost Dog & Cat Rescue Foundation will bring cats and dogs looking for a good home to Port City for an adoption fair from 2-5 p.m. 

Lost Dog Rescue Ale will be available for the frist time in the Tasting Room that day.

ABOUT THE BEER:
Lost Dog Rescue Ale is an American IPA with a strong citrus aroma, fruit-forward hop flavor, and spicy rye malt character. The beer was dry-hopped using Port City’s patented Hopzooka®.
7.0% ABV / 60 IBUs

ABOUT LOST DOG AND CAT RESCUE FOUNDATION
Lost Dog & Cat Rescue Foundation (LDCRF), a 501(c)3 non-profit corporation devoted to helping homeless dogs and cats find forever homes, was founded in 2001 to help continue and expand the rescue efforts of the original Lost Dog Café. Today, LDCRF finds homes for 2,000+ animals per year and estimates more than 30,000 lives have been saved since its inception. The foundation’s success is due in no small part to the continued support and growth of the Lost Dog Café restaurants and its loyal customers.
